Output 87d20c8fa626b600ee2ca749660d22ea5d9a29cd9030b66f08b208f6c81eec04:0

value
695800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5576b3ea3b40a7601fdd882bad26d13da21d16dd OP_EQUAL
address
39UuZTs4zsb4TDkM16UJDVJHuSgHvjhzab
transaction
87d20c8fa626b600ee2ca749660d22ea5d9a29cd9030b66f08b208f6c81eec04
confirmations
260249
spent
true